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
999255550 44143 5808915 25 50
563 198483 773
563 198483 773
84171182 61750 674052 657 41214
All about undefined
Interested in learning more?
563 198483 773
84171182 61750 674052 657 41214
See more
2076331 1305255314 5686916
5004 779 59535735
See more
22743312 10790223305 32565232
229 5586 884505 1784017854 364
See more